Program Fee

Fee Type Amount Notes
Tuition and Orientation $4,480 All of Arcadia's summer programs include elements that we believe are essential to a successful and enriching academic experience abroad. Program fees include tuition, orientation, full support services throughout the program, pre- and post-program advisory services, student health and accident insurance and transcript.
Room $2,500 The housing portion of our program fee assumes self-catered, shared accommodations for the program weeks listed. Students in catered housing, single accommodations, enhanced or extended accommodations could be subject to additional fees.
Total Program Fee $6,980 Enrollment selections incurring additional fees will be billed several weeks after programs begin. Estimate of Additional Expenses

Fee Type Amount Notes
Books $85
Meals $850 This estimate is based on the cost of meals prepared by the student in the residence facilities provided.
Personal $670 Incidental or miscellaneous costs associated with daily living in the host city contributing to successful progress in the program.
Student Visa $710 The visa cost information provided includes a fee of $192 for priority service which is recommended by Arcadia but not required for visa processing. UPS shipping costs are not included in this estimate. Visa fees are subject to change.
Local Travel $180 Estimated travel costs from the student residence to the instruction site throughout the course of the program.
Program Travel $1,100 The program fee does not include the cost of traveling to and from the program location. The estimated cost of airfare is based on leaving from and returning to the New York area. Students connecting from other locations will need to budget for additional travel costs.
Total Estimate of Additional Expenses $3,595 These estimates intend to assist students in planning their budget during their experience abroad. These amounts will vary depending on individual spending habits. Exchange rate of USD 1.52 to GBP 1.00 was used in determining the above estimates.



Total Estimated Cost of Attendance

$10,575

The Total Estimated Cost of Attendance includes the Program Fee and Estimate of Additional Expenses. Enrollment selections outlined in the Additional Fees section may increase the overall Estimated Cost of Attendance by the fee amounts listed.
